Senior-Level Machinist

Essential Job

To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ty with minimal material/tool waste/scrap.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

This position must also be able to perform the following essential job functions/job duties on a consistent basis, within the estimated run times, with a minimum quantity of errors:

  • Build tools and load them in the machine while accurately touching them off.
  • Read and write basic G&M code programming, including cutter compensation.
  • Maintain quality when tool wear affects part quality, and understand the process of adjustment to maintain quality.
  • Communicate effectively with the CAD/CAM programmer on how to process work to eliminate set-up mistakes.
  • Edit job program in regards to speeds and feeds to improve job processing.
  • Use Renishaw probing system to establish Datum points for work offsets.
  • Machine long running jobs with minimum supervision.
  • Proficient in reading and understanding blue prints including geometric tolerance.
  • Proficient in uploading and downloading programs from a thumb drive and able to call up different programs in the internal memory of the machine tool.
  • Work with quality department to verify quality of the parts following set-ups.
  • Maintain quality for jobs that have been set-up for production.
  • With assistance/guidance, set-up and proof jobs on the Haas Vertical/Horizontal milling machines.
  • Set up, program, and edit “B” axis and utilize 4th axis rotary tables.
  • Set up and proof jobs on the Haas Horizontal/Vertical Mill machines without needing any direction from lead or supervisor.
  • Convey ideas and suggestion for the betterment of set-up efficiency.
  • Design/Build specialized tooling and work holding fixtures as required.
  • Read and write advance G&M code programming, including cutter compensation and all canned cycles.
  • Be proficient in expressing ideas to the CAD/CAM programmer in order to process work efficiently.
  • Must work independently and able to instruct and train entry-level machine operators.
  • Obtain pictures of new or improved set-ups and load finished programs on USB for E2 set-up library.
  • Assist Sales Team or Estimator with estimated run times and tooling requirements during the quoting process when needed.

Qualifications

The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required.

Education:

  • High school diploma or GED, required.

Experience:

  • Must meet or exceed all the requirements of mid-level Mill Machine Operator.
  • Experience with reading and writing advance G&M code programming.

Other Required Knowledge, Skills & Abilities:

  • U.S. Citizenship
  • Able to read and write English
  • Must own tools that are needed to set-up any CNC Machine on the shop floor: tape measure, set of Allen wrenches, end wrenches, dial indicator, 6” or 12” scale.
  • Must own inspection tools in order to properly check machined parts: dial calipers 8” or 12”, depth micrometers 0-6”, OD micrometers 0-4”.
  • Must be proficient in reading and understanding blueprints including geometric tolerance.
  • Must be able to read and write G&M code programming, including cutter compensation and all canned cycles.

Working Conditions

  • Working Environment: Manufacturing, dusty, Moderate noise level
  • Physical Demands: Sitting/Standing for extended periods of time, able to lift up to 40lbs. consistently, with the occasional 70lbs.
  • Required PPE: Safety glasses, steel toe shoes
